Tioga was the 7-4 winner over Quitman when they last played one another back in April of 2022, but their luck changed this time around. The Indians fell just short of the Wolverines by a score of 4-3 on Monday.
Tioga's loss dropped their record down to 20-7. As for Quitman, with the win, they broke their four-game losing streak and moved their record to 18-9.
Coming up, Tioga will take on North DeSoto at 5:30 p.m. on Tuesday. The two teams have allowed few runs on average (the Indians 3.7, the Griffins 2.4) so any runs scored will be well earned. As for Quitman, they will venture away from home to face off against Haughton at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
